Definition
领事馆 (lǐngshìguǎn) is a consulate — a diplomatic office in a foreign city that handles visas, passports, and citizens' affairs. It is lower in rank than 使馆 (shǐguǎn), which is an embassy located in a capital city. The related word 领事 (lǐngshì) refers to the consul who works there, not the building.
